Revolutionary Algorithm Boosts Optical Imaging by 30%

Story summary
  • Researchers from Eindhoven University of Technology, NASA, and Harvard University created a quantum-inspired algorithm to improve optical imaging.
  • It encodes light into quantum bits, enhancing the signal-to-noise ratio by 30% and spatial resolution by 20%.
  • The technique captures weak signals, like exoplanets, while reducing sampling complexity.
  • It processes signals asynchronously without traditional quantum Fourier transforms, enabling efficient eigenstate sampling.
  • This advancement could transform astronomy, biomedical imaging, and remote sensing.
